The project’s aim was to facilitate the best possible integration of asylum seekers. Human dignity was the core focus in the project’s planning and implementation. Particular emphasis was planed on meeting individual needs in the sanitary area, installing a playground for children, and creating a room for volunteers to enable active social support.
